Gabriel Doria Obituary

Gabriel Francis Doria, Sr. – a lifelong resident of Bayonne, passed away peacefully, surrounded by his family, on Sunday, February 19th, 2023, at 92. Gabriel served his country proudly as a member of The United States Army, stationed in Germany during the Korean Conflict. He was a 4th-degree member and Captain of The Color Guard for The Bayonne Knights of Columbus Star of the Sea Council #371. In 1951, Gabriel received a degree in liberal arts from Bayonne Junior College and graduated with a degree in chemical engineering from Seton Hall University in 1955. Before his retirement, he worked for over thirty years as Regional Sales Manager for Borden Chemical. He was well respected and recognized by his colleagues and customers as the best in his field. Gabriel provided many years of stewardship at St. Henry's Parish in Bayonne as an usher, Eucharistic Minister, and on numerous parish task forces and committees. Gabriel was devoted to the love of his life, Elsie (nee: Alfano) Doria, who passed away in 2019. He was a proud father to Dr. Gabriel Doria, Jr. (Tricia), Lisa Doria-Cavuoto (Robert), and Christopher Doria (Karen) and a loving grandfather to Gianna, Nicole, Gabriel III, Cassandra, Alexa, Christina & Bella. Gabriel was predeceased by his siblings Mary Thomas (John), Leticia Laskie (Michael), Vivian Puccio (Alfred), and Joseph Doria, and surviving him is a host of nieces, nephews and dear friends and relatives he cherished dearly.
